A couple of days ago I started having issues with my graphics card. When I booted up my system, I noticed the resolution on my desktop (native 1920x1200) had been knocked down to 1024x768. Any attempt to change it fails as other resolutions are greyed out.
I also can't access Nvidia Control Panel. Checking the card under Device Manager shows the message - "Windows has stopped this device because it has reported problems. (Code 43)".
I've tried…
Uninstalling and reinstalling drivers
Rolling back to older drivers
Physically removed the card and checked/cleaned all connectors.
Swapping PCI slots
Still getting the same error code. Any ideas?
